Did you know that more than 200,000 incoming college freshmen have a learning disability? Students with learning disabilities may find it difficult to acquire knowledge through traditional teaching methods. Moreover, dropout rates for this population are much higher than for their peers. Fortunately, with the right resources and modified teaching and learning techniques, students with disabilities can thrive in college. Read on to learn more.
